St Augustine's Roman Catholic High School, Billington is a Maintained school (Voluntary aided school) with a Roman Catholic religious character. The school consists of mixed pupils aged between 11 and 16 and has a capacity of 1075. The school was last rated as Outstanding by Ofsted on 28 Nov 2013.

This school has strong academic results. It is in the top 30% of Secondary schools in England based on Key Stage 4 GCSE performance and ranking according to the Attainment 8 score (how well pupils of the school have performed in up to 8 qualifications).
